The Short Answer: Does Krispy Krunchy Chicken Accept EBT?
Unfortunately, in most cases, Krispy Krunchy Chicken locations do *not* accept EBT cards directly. They are usually located inside convenience stores or gas stations. However, the individual store that houses the Krispy Krunchy Chicken might accept EBT if the store itself is a qualified EBT retailer.
Where Krispy Krunchy Chicken is Usually Found
Krispy Krunchy Chicken is often found in convenient locations, not necessarily a restaurant you think of when you want to dine-in. It’s usually inside other businesses. This means their EBT acceptance depends on the host store’s policy. Think about it like this: It’s a “shop-within-a-shop” kind of deal.

How to Determine if a Location Accepts EBT
Since Krispy Krunchy Chicken doesn’t always accept EBT directly, you need to check the host store. There are a few easy ways to find out if they take EBT.
First, just look for signs! Businesses that accept EBT will usually have a sign posted near the entrance or the cash register. It’s a simple way to find out.
You can also ask! Don’t be shy about asking the cashier. They’ll be able to tell you for sure.
Finally, a quick phone call can be super helpful. Call the store ahead of time and ask if they accept EBT. This way, you won’t have to be surprised at the checkout.
